Wind Down: Alpha→Delta Sleep Journey

Gradual transition from relaxed alpha (10Hz) to deep-sleep delta (1.5Hz). Delta-band stimulation before sleep is associated with enhanced slow-wave sleep and sleep-dependent memory consolidation.

30 minbinaural432 Hz carrier· Best: Pre-sleep — last 30 min of your wind-down routine

Research note. Slow-oscillation stimulation during sleep boosts memory consolidation (Marshall et al., 2006, Nature). Delta-band activity is a reliable EEG marker of restorative slow-wave sleep.

Sharpen: 40Hz Gamma Cognitive Protocol

Gamma-band (40Hz) auditory stimulation, inspired by the GENUS protocol from MIT (Tsai lab). In mice, 40Hz stimulation reduced amyloid plaques and engaged microglial activity; in humans it is being studied as a safe, non-invasive cognitive-health intervention. Framed as cognitive stimulation, not treatment.

22 minisochronic440 Hz carrier· Best: Morning or mid-afternoon cognitive block

Research note. 40Hz sensory stimulation drives gamma oscillations and microglial response (Iaccarino, Singer et al., 2016, Nature). Ongoing human trials (Chan 2022, PLOS ONE) report good safety and subjective cognitive benefits.

Pre-Sleep Vagal Wind-Down (0.1Hz Breathing)

Ten-minute respiration pacer at 0.1Hz (10s in, 10s out via 6 breaths/min). Targets the baroreflex resonance frequency — the strongest known acute booster of HRV.

10 minbinaural256 Hz carrier· Best: 10 minutes before lights-out

Research note. Resonance breathing at ~0.1Hz produces the largest acute increase in HRV and baroreflex sensitivity of any documented breathing pattern (Lehrer et al., 2014).

Solfeggio 528Hz — Traditional Tone

Premium

A sustained 528Hz tone from the Solfeggio tuning system. There is no peer-reviewed evidence for health effects of 528Hz (nor the other Solfeggio frequencies), but many users find the tone pleasant for meditation. Presented honestly as tradition, not science.

25 minmonaural528 Hz carrier· Best: Quiet meditation sessions

Research note. Solfeggio frequencies originate from a medieval chant tradition. Claims of cellular or DNA effects are not supported by peer-reviewed research.

Schumann 7.83Hz — Grounding Tone

Premium

7.83Hz is the fundamental frequency of the Earth-ionosphere cavity (Schumann resonance). Some practitioners find this frequency grounding for meditation. Claims of specific biological effects remain unproven.

25 minbinaural432 Hz carrier· Best: Grounding meditation or outdoor listening

Research note. Schumann resonance is real atmospheric physics (~7.83Hz). Biological entrainment claims (Cherry 2002) are contested and not supported by replicated RCTs.
